Language as a Cultural Heritage For the French people, the language is the cornerstone of national sovereignty and cultural pride. The French language, or «la langue française», is not merely a tool for utility; it is the primary vessel for expressing a national identity built on reason, elegance, and historical prestige.

The use of «vous» versus «tu» is a complex social algorithm that dictates formality, intimacy, and respect, instantly defining the hierarchy between speakers. The language shifts dramatically from the lyrical cadence of southern France to the guttural rhythms of the north, reflecting distinct historical influences and local identities.

To learn French is to step into a world where logic meets passion, and where every sentence is an opportunity to engage with centuries of cultural depth. Purists within the French government aggressively defend the language through institutions like the Académie Française, yet the younger generation seamlessly blends slang and digital jargon, creating a living, breathing dialect that is both traditional and cutting-edge.
